Summary

'Kyleina' is a fine example of the John Butler designed Westerly Cirrus. This pocket cruiser was introduced in 1968 and she proved so popular as a capable entry level cruiser that 398 were built in the 5 years she was in production. Her fin keel, inboard engine, 4 berths and turn of speed made her an ideal family cruiser. Currently ashore on her trailer, she has a pristine suit of Crusader sails, New batteries and new forestay. Mechanical

Vessel is powered by a 10hp Inboard Volvo Penta MD 2000 diesel engine. This single cylinder workhorse has only completed 200 hours since the engine was installed. Most recent service was in May 2024.
Reduction gearbox driving a stainless steel shaft and 2-bladed fixed propeller. Single engine lever control with forward and reverse gearing.

Electrical

Vessel has 2, brand NEW 12V batteries fitted providing engine start and domestic power. These are recharged via the engine alternator.

Rigging

Bermudan sloop rigged yacht with deck stepped aluminium mast and boom. Stainless steel standing rigging with new forestay in 2024. Terylene running rigging in an as new condition.
Selden 100S roller furling system. Sails include a Crusader main and Genoa from 2001. These are new and never been out of the bags.

Accommodation

Surprisingly spacious for her 22 foot length. Interior is accessed from the cockpit via a sliding hatch and washboard combination. There are 4 berths with a double in the forepeak, a quarter berth on the port side and a long single to starboard made possible by dropping the dining table. Small galley to port featuring a gas fuelled Plastimo Neptune 2500 2-burner hob with grill, sink unit with hand pumped water and storage.
comfortable upholstery covered in red velour. Bright interior with headlining removed and surface painted.
toilet compartment with marine toilet.

Construction

GRP constructed yacht with fin keel. Cockpit with storage lockers and varnished wooden tiller steering. White topsides with blue cove line striping. Hull to deck join finished in teak strip.
Stainless steel stern and bow rails joined by stanchions and single set of guard wires. Hull antifouled in black coatings
